Inkqubo yokuvelisa isixhobo se-cubic boron nitride (CBN).

1. Indlela yokuhlanjululwa kwezinto ezibonakalayo

Ngenxa yokuba i-WBN, i-HBN, i-pyrophyllite, igraphite, i-magnesium, isinyithi kunye nezinye izinto ezingcolileyo zihlala kwi-CBN powder;Ukongeza, yona kunye ne-binder powder iqulethe i-oksijeni ye-adsorbed, umphunga wamanzi, njl., engathandekiyo kwi-sintering.Ngoko ke, indlela yokuhlanjululwa kwezinto eziluhlaza yenye yezona zikhonkco ezibalulekileyo zokuqinisekisa ukusebenza kweepolycrystals zokwenziwa.Ngethuba lophuhliso, sasebenzisa iindlela ezilandelayo zokuhlambulula i-micropowder ye-CBN kunye nezinto ezibophezelayo: okokuqala, phatha i-CBN uphawu lwepowder kunye ne-NaOH malunga ne-300C ukususa i-pyrophyllite kunye ne-HBN;Emva koko ubilise i-perchloric acid ukususa igraphite;Ekugqibeleni, sebenzisa i-HCl ukubilisa kwipleyiti yokufudumeza yombane ukususa isinyithi, kwaye uyihlambe ingathathi hlangothi ngamanzi adibeneyo.I-Co, i-Ni, i-Al, njl. esetyenziselwa ukudibanisa iphathwa ngokunciphisa i-hydrogen.Emva koko i-CBN kunye ne-binder ixutywe ngokulinganayo ngokomlinganiselo othile kwaye yongezwa kwi-graphite mold, kwaye ithunyelwe kwi-vacuum furnace kunye noxinzelelo olungaphantsi kwe-1E2, ishushu kwi-800 ~ 1000 ° C nge-1h ukususa ukungcola, i-oksijini ye-adsorbed. kunye nomphunga wamanzi kumphezulu wayo, ukuze umphezulu wengqolowa we-CBN ucoceke kakhulu.

Ngokumalunga nokukhethwa kunye nokongezwa kwezixhobo zokudibanisa, iintlobo zee-agent ezidibeneyo ezisetyenziswa ngoku kwi-polycrystals ye-CBN zinokushwankathelwa zibe ziindidi ezintathu:

(1) Izibophelelo zesinyithi, ezifana noTi, Co, Ni.I-Cu, i-Cr, i-W kunye nezinye isinyithi okanye i-alloys, kulula ukuthambisa kumaqondo okushisa aphezulu, okuchaphazela ubomi besixhobo;

(2) Ibhondi yeCeramic, efana ne-Al2O3, iyamelana nobushushu obuphezulu, kodwa inefuthe elibi, kwaye isixhobo silula ukuwa kunye nomonakalo;

(3) Ibhondi ye-Cermet, njengesisombululo esiqinileyo esenziwe yi-carbides, i-nitrides, i-borides kunye ne-Co, i-Ni, njl., isombulula ukusilela kwezi ntlobo zimbini zingentla.Isixa esipheleleyo sesibophelelo siya kwanela kodwa singagqithisi.Iziphumo zovavanyo zibonisa ukuba ukuxhathisa ukunxiba kunye nokugoba amandla e-polycrystal ahambelana ngokusondeleyo nomndilili wendlela yasimahla (ubunzima bomaleko wesigaba sokubopha), xa umyinge wendlela yasimahla ingu-0.8 ~ 1.2 μ M, umlinganiselo wokunxiba wepolycrystalline uphezulu, kwaye isixa se-binder yi-10% ~ 15% (umlinganiselo wobunzima).

2. I-Cubic boron nitride (CBN) isixhobo se-embryo sinokuhlulwa sibe ngamacandelo amabini
Enye kukubeka umxube we-CBN kunye ne-agent edibeneyo kunye ne-samente ye-carbide matrix kwikomityi ye-molybdenum eyahlulwe ngumaleko okhuselayo wetyhubhu yetyuwa.

Enye kukufaka ngokuthe ngqo i-polycrystalline CBN cutter body ngaphandle kwe-alloy substrate: ukwamkela umshicileli ophezulu onamacala amathandathu, kwaye usebenzise indibano yokufudumeza esecaleni.Hlanganisa i-CBN micro-powder edibeneyo, uyibambe ixesha elithile phantsi koxinzelelo oluthile kunye nozinzo, kwaye ngokucothayo uyiwise kwiqondo lobushushu begumbi kwaye ngokucothayo uyikhuphele kuxinzelelo oluqhelekileyo.I-polycrystalline CBN knife embryo yenziwe

3. Iiparamitha zejometri ze-cubic boron nitride (CBN) isixhobo

Ubomi benkonzo ye-cubic boron nitride (CBN) isixhobo sinxulumene ngokusondeleyo neeparamitha zayo zejometri.Ii-angles zangaphambili ezifanelekileyo kunye nasemva zingaphucula ukuchasana kwempembelelo yesixhobo.Umthamo wokususwa kwe-Chip kunye nomthamo wokutshatyalaliswa kobushushu.Ubungakanani be-rake angle buchaphazela ngokuthe ngqo imeko yoxinzelelo lwecala lokusika kunye noxinzelelo lwangaphakathi lwe-blade.Ukuze ugweme uxinzelelo olugqithisileyo olubangelwa yimpembelelo yomatshini kwincam yesixhobo, i-angle yangaphambili engalunganga (- 5 ° ~ - 10 °) yamkelwa ngokubanzi.Ngexesha elifanayo, ukwenzela ukunciphisa ukunxiba kwe-angle yangasemva, ii-angles eziphambili kunye ne-axiliary ngasemva ziyi-6 °, i-radius ye-tip yesixhobo i-0.4 - 1.2 mm, kwaye i-chamfer iphantsi komhlaba.

4. Ukuhlolwa kwezixhobo ze-cubic boron nitride (CBN).
Ukongeza kuvavanyo lwesalathiso sobulukhuni, amandla okugoba, amandla okuqina kunye nezinye iipropathi zomzimba, kubaluleke kakhulu ukusebenzisa i-electron microscope yamandla aphezulu ukujonga umphezulu kunye nomphetho wonyango oluchanekileyo lwencakuba nganye.Okulandelayo kukuhlolwa komlinganiselo, ukuchaneka komlinganiselo, ixabiso le-M, ukunyamezela kwejometri, uburhabaxa besixhobo, kunye nokupakishwa kunye nokugcinwa kwempahla.
